1. 
Smart FAN Control: This is the default setting of 
SilentTek and can be used for any branded computer 
housing. With a special algorithm developed by AOpen, 
the fan speed is automatically adjusted by the factors of 
CPU and ambient temperature. Ease-of-use and trouble 
free at your service. 
2. 
Fixed FAN Control: Under this setting, a desired fan 
speed is set fixed when operating. 
3. 
Multiple Level Control: This is the most versatile 
setting that allows you to set fan speed in relation to 
temperature. You may find that this setting fits you best. 
4. 
AOpen Recommend Setting: This setting is designed 
specifically for AOpen housing. A series of lab tests were 
conducted under the real world scenario to determine 
optimum fan speed to reduce noise level within CPU 
working condition and temperature. Most of the time, the 
fan would remain still when CPU is not fully utilized.

CD-ROM Rotation Speed Control: by enabling the CD-ROM 
Rotation Speed Control, you can adjust the rotation speed of your 
CD-ROM. When you set the speed to high level, the CD-ROM will 
work at its fastest speed and it will run at basic required speed 
while you set the value to low speed.
